Safety information

Electrical safety

  • To prevent electrical shock hazard, disconnect the power cable from the electrical outlet before relocating the system.
  • When adding or removing devices to or from the system, ensure that the power cables for the devices are unplugged before the signal cables are connected. If possible, disconnect all power cables from the existing system before you add a device.
  • Before connecting or removing signal cables from the motherboard, ensure that all power cables are unplugged.
  • Seek professional assistance before using an adapter or extension cord. These devices could interrupt the grounding circuit.
  • Ensure that your power supply is set to the correct voltage in your area. If you are not sure about the voltage of the electrical outlet you are using, contact your local power company.
  • If the power supply is broken, do not try to fix it by yourself. Contact a qualified service technician or your retailer.

Operation safety

  • Before installing the motherboard and adding devices on it, carefully read all the manuals that came with the package.
  • Before using the product, ensure all cables are correctly connected and the power cables are not damaged. If you detect any damage, contact your dealer immediately.
  • To avoid short circuits, keep paper clips, screws, and staples away from connectors, slots, sockets and circuitry.
  • Avoid dust, humidity, and temperature extremes. Do not place the product in any area where it may become wet.
  • Place the product on a stable surface.
  • If you encounter technical problems with the product, contact a qualified service technician or your retailer.
  • Your motherboard should only be used in environments with ambient temperatures between 0°C and 40°C.

  • PCIEX16_2 shares bandwidth with PCIEX1_1, PCIEX1_2, and PCIEX1_3. When PCIEX16_2 runs x4 mode, PCIEX1_1, PCIEX1_2, and PCIEX1_3 will be disabled. PCIEX16_2 will run x1 mode when PCIEX1_1, PCIEX1_2, or PCIEX1_3 is occupied.
  • When M.2_2 slot is populated, SATA6G_56 will be disabled.

1.1 Before you proceed

Take note of the following precautions before you install motherboard components or change any motherboard settings.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Before you proceed - 1

  • Unplug the power cord from the wall socket before touching any component.
  • Before handling components, use a grounded wrist strap or touch a safely grounded object or a metal object, such as the power supply case, to avoid damaging them due to static electricity.
  • Hold components by the edges to avoid touching the ICs on them.
  • Whenever you uninstall any component, place it on a grounded antistatic pad or in the bag that came with the component.
  • Before you install or remove any component, ensure that the ATX power supply is switched off or the power cord is detached from the power supply. Failure to do so may cause severe damage to the motherboard, peripherals, or components.

Memory configurations

You may install 4 GB, 8 GB, 16 GB, and 32 GB unbuffered ECC and non-ECC DDR4 DIMMs into the DIMM sockets.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Memory configurations - 1

You may install varying memory sizes in Channel A and Channel B. The system maps the total size of the lower-sized channel for the dual-channel configuration. Any excess memory from the higher-sized channel is then mapped for single-channel operation.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Memory configurations - 2

  • The default memory operation frequency is dependent on its Serial Presence Detect (SPD), which is the standard way of accessing information from a memory module. Under the default state, some memory modules for overclocking may operate at a lower frequency than the vendor-marked value.
  • For system stability, use a more efficient memory cooling system to support a full memory load or overclocking condition.
  • Always install the DIMMS with the same CAS Latency. For an optimum compatibility, we recommend that you install memory modules of the same version or data code (D/C) from the same vendor. Check with the vendor to get the correct memory modules.
  • Visit the ASUS website for the latest QVL.

  • DO NOT connect the 4-pin power plug only. The motherboard may overheat under heavy usage.
  • Ensure to connect the 8-pin power plug, or connect both the 8-pin and 4-pin power plugs.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Power connectors - 6

  • For a fully configured system, we recommend that you use a power supply unit (PSU) that complies with ATX 12V Specification 2.0 (or later version) and provides a minimum power of 350W.
  • We recommend that you use a PSU with a higher power output when configuring a system with more power-consuming devices. The system may become unstable or may not boot up if the power is inadequate.
  • If you want to use two or more high-end PCI Express x16 cards, use a PSU with 1000W power or above to ensure the system stability.

6. M.2 slots

The M.2 slots allow you to install M.2 devices such as M.2 SSD modules.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- M.2 slots - 1

text_image A B A M.2_1(SOCKET3) B M.2_2(SOCKET3)

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- M.2 slots - 2

  • M.2_1 slot supports PCIe 4.0 x4 and SATA modes Key M design and type 2242/2260/2280/22110 storage devices.
  • M.2_2 slot supports PCIe 3.0 x4 and SATA modes Key M design and type 2242/2260/2280/22110 storage devices.
  • When M.2_2 slot is populated, SATA6G_5/6 will be disabled.

12. Clear CMOS header

This header allows you to clear the Real Time Clock (RTC) RAM in CMOS. You can clear the CMOS memory of date, time, and system setup parameters by erasing the CMOS RTC RAM data. The onboard button cell battery powers the RAM data in CMOS, which include system setup information such as system passwords.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Clear CMOS header - 1

text_image CLRTC +3V_BAT GND PIN 1

To erase the RTC RAM:

  1. Turn OFF the computer and unplug the power cord.
  2. Use a metal object such as a screwdriver to short the two pins.
  3. Plug the power cord and turn on the computer.
  4. Hold down the key during the boot process and enter BIOS setup to re-enter data.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To erase the RTC RAM: - 1

DO NOT short-circuit the pins except when clearing the RTC RAM. Short-circuiting or placing a jumper cap will cause system boot failure!

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To erase the RTC RAM: - 2

If the steps above do not help, remove the onboard battery and short the two pins again to clear the CMOS RTC RAM data. After clearing the CMOS, reinstall the battery.

14. System Panel header

The System Panel header supports several chassis-mounted functions.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- System Panel header - 1

text_image /USB PRIME 2480+V

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- System Panel header - 2

text_image PANEL PIN 1 PLED+ PWRSW SPEAKER +5V Ground Ground Speaker HDD_LED+ Ground RSTCON# NC PLED+ HDD_LED- Ground RSTCON# NC PLED- RESET PLED

• System power LED (2-pin PLED)

This 2-pin header is for the system power LED. Connect the chassis power LED cable to this header. The system power LED lights up when you turn on the system power, and blinks when the system is in sleep mode.

- Hard disk drive activity LED (2-pin HDD\_LED)

This 2-pin header is for the HDD Activity LED. Connect the HDD Activity LED cable to this header. The HDD LED lights up or flashes when data is read from or written to the HDD.

- System warning speaker (4-pin SPEAKER)

This 4-pin header is for the chassis-mounted system warning speaker. The speaker allows you to hear system beeps and warnings.

- ATX power button/soft-off button (2-pin PWRSW)

This header is for the system power button. Pressing the power button turns the system on or puts the system in sleep or soft-off mode depending on the operating system settings. Pressing the power switch for more than four seconds while the system is ON turns the system OFF.

- Reset button (2-pin RESET)

This 2-pin header is for the chassis-mounted reset button for system reboot without turning off the system power.

BIOS FlashBack™

BIOS FlashBack™ allows you to easily update the BIOS without entering the existing BIOS or operating system. Simply insert a USB storage device to the USB port (the USB port hole is marked on the I/O shield) then press the BIOS FlashBack™ button for three seconds to automatically update the BIOS.

To use BIOS FlashBack™:

  1. Insert a USB storage device to the BIOS FlashBack™ port.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To use BIOS FlashBack™: - 1

We recommend you to use a USB 2.0 storage device to save the latest BIOS version for better compatibility and stability.

  1. Visit https://www.asus.com/support/ and download the latest BIOS version for this motherboard.

  2. Manually rename the file as RB550FGW.CAP, or launch the BIOSRenamer.exe application to automatically rename the file, then copy it to your USB storage device.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To use BIOS FlashBack™: - 2

The BIOSRenamer.exe application is zipped together with your BIOS file when you download a BIOS file for a BIOS FlashBack™ compatible motherboard.

  1. Shut down your computer.
  2. Press the BIOS FlashBack™ button for three seconds until the BIOS FlashBack™ LED blinks three times, indicating that the BIOS FlashBack™ function is enabled.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To use BIOS FlashBack™: - 3

natural_image Diagram of server rack and front panel layout with no visible text or symbols

BIOS FlashBack™ button BIOS FlashBack™ port

  1. Wait until the light goes out, indicating that the BIOS updating process is completed.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To use BIOS FlashBack™: - 4

For more BIOS update utilities in BIOS setup, refer to the section Updating BIOS in Chapter 3.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To use BIOS FlashBack™: - 5

  • Do not unplug portable disk, power system, or short the CLRTC header while BIOS update is ongoing, otherwise update will be interrupted. In case of interruption, please follow the steps again.
  • If the light flashes for five seconds and turns into a solid light, this means that the BIOS FlashBack™ is not operating properly. This may be caused by improper installation of the USB storage device and filename/file format error. If this scenario happens, please restart the system to turn off the light.
  • Updating BIOS may have risks. If the BIOS program is damaged during the process and results to the system's failure to boot up, please contact your local ASUS Service Center.

2.4 Starting up for the first time

  1. After making all the connections, replace the system case cover.
  2. Ensure that all switches are off.
  3. Connect the power cord to the power connector at the back of the system chassis.
  4. Connect the power cord to a power outlet that is equipped with a surge protector.
  5. Turn on the devices in the following order:

a. Monitor

b. External storage devices (starting with the last device on the chain)
c. System power

  1. After applying power, the system power LED on the system front panel case lights up. For systems with ATX power supplies, the system LED lights up when you press the ATX power button. If your monitor complies with the "green" standards or if it has a "power standby" feature, the monitor LED may light up or change from orange to green after the system LED turns on.

The system then runs the power-on self tests (POST). While the tests are running, the BIOS beeps (refer to the BIOS beep codes table) or additional messages appear on the screen. If you do not see anything within 30 seconds from the time you turned on the power, the system may have failed a power-on test. Check the jumper settings and connections or call your retailer for assistance.

BIOS Beep Description
One short beepVGA detectedQuick boot set to disabledNo keyboard detected
One continuous beep followed by two short beeps then a pause (repeated)No memory detected
One continuous beep followed by three short beepsNo VGA detected
One continuous beep followed by four short beepsHardware component failure
  1. At power on, hold down the key to enter the BIOS Setup. Follow the instructions in Chapter 3.

2.5 Turning off the computer

While the system is ON, press the power button for less than four seconds to put the system on sleep mode or soft-off mode, depending on the BIOS setting. Press the power button for more than four seconds to let the system enter the soft-off mode regardless of the BIOS setting.

3.1 Knowing BIOS

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Knowing BIOS - 1

The new ASUS UEFI BIOS is a Unified Extensible Interface that complies with UEFI architecture, offering a user-friendly interface that goes beyond the traditional keyboard-only BIOS controls to enable a more flexible and convenient mouse input. You can easily navigate the new UEFI BIOS with the same smoothness as your operating system. The term "BIOS" in this user manual refers to "UEFI BIOS" unless otherwise specified.

BIOS (Basic Input and Output System) stores system hardware settings such as storage device configuration, overclocking settings, advanced power management, and boot device configuration that are needed for system startup in the motherboard CMOS. In normal circumstances, the default BIOS settings apply to most conditions to ensure optimal performance. DO NOT change the default BIOS settings except in the following circumstances:

  • An error message appears on the screen during the system bootup and requests you to run the BIOS Setup.
  • You have installed a new system component that requires further BIOS settings or update.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Knowing BIOS - 2

Inappropriate BIOS settings may result to instability or boot failure. We strongly recommend that you change the BIOS settings only with the help of a trained service personnel.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- Knowing BIOS - 3

  • When downloading or updating the BIOS file, rename it as RB550FGW.CAP for this motherboard.
  • BIOS settings and options may vary due to different BIOS release versions. Please refer to the latest BIOS version for settings and options.

3.5 ASUS CrashFree BIOS 3

The ASUS CrashFree BIOS 3 utility is an auto recovery tool that allows you to restore the BIOS file when it fails or gets corrupted during the updating process. You can restore a corrupted BIOS file using a USB flash drive that contains the BIOS file.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- ASUS CrashFree BIOS 3 - 1

If you want to use the latest BIOS file, download the file at https://www.asus.com/support, and save it to a USB flash drive.

Recovering the BIOS

To recover the BIOS:

  1. Turn on the system.
  2. Insert the USB flash drive containing the BIOS file to the USB port.
  3. The utility automatically checks the devices for the BIOS file. When found, the utility reads the BIOS file and enters ASUS EZ Flash 3 automatically.
  4. The system requires you to enter BIOS Setup to recover the BIOS setting. To ensure system compatibility and stability, we recommend that you press to load default BIOS values.

ASUS ROG Strix B550-F WIFI - To recover the BIOS: - 1

DO NOT shut down or reset the system while updating the BIOS! Doing so can cause system boot failure!

RAID definitions

RAID 0 (Data striping) optimizes two identical hard disk drives to read and write data in parallel, interleaved stacks. Two hard disks perform the same work as a single drive but at a sustained data transfer rate, double that of a single disk alone, thus improving data access and storage. Use of two new identical hard disk drives is required for this setup.

RAID 1 (Data mirroring) copies and maintains an identical image of data from one drive to a second drive. If one drive fails, the disk array management software directs all applications to the surviving drive as it contains a complete copy of the data in the other drive. This RAID configuration provides data protection and increases fault tolerance to the entire system. Use two new drives or use an existing drive and a new drive for this setup. The new drive must be of the same size or larger than the existing drive.

RAID 10 is data striping and data mirroring combined without parity (redundancy data) having to be calculated and written. With the RAID 10 configuration you get all the benefits of both RAID 0 and RAID 1 configurations. Use four new hard disk drives or use an existing drive and three new drives for this setup.
